CAF Club Competitions: Nigerian clubs seek to avoid early exit

February 19, 2017
in Sports
1 min read
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

Nigeria Professional Football League, NPFL teams campaigning in CAF Club competitions have their work well cut out this Sunday as they face different African clubs in their second leg preliminary ties.

Rivers United Football Club [Photo Credit: Africasports24]

The four clubs, Enugu Rangers, Rivers United, Wikki Tourists and FC Ifeanyi Ubah, are all united in their resolve not to exit the continent very early; but they would have to match their words with action on the pitch to stay in contention.

Going by their first leg results, none of the teams representing Nigeria are home and dry, and so they will have to be at their best if they are to make it to the first round of both the CAF Champions League as well as the CAF Confederations Cup.
